🍲 Broccoli and Kohlrabi Pot with Gremolata
283 kcal · 30 min · 4 servings

Ingredients
- 1 clove garlic
- 1 broccoli
- 3 stalks celery
- 1 kohlrabi
- 3 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p turmeric powder
- 800 ml vegetable broth
- salt
- pepper
- 1 bunch parsley (20 g)
- 4 tbsp hazelnut kernels (60 g)
- 0.5 organic lemon (zest)
- chili flakes
Instructions
- 1. Peel the garlic clove and chop it finely. Clean the broccoli and celery stalks, wash them well, and divide the broccoli into small florets and the celery into small pieces. Peel the kohlrabi and cut it into small cubes.
- 2. Heat one tablespoon of oil in a pot. Sauté the garlic, kohlrabi cubes, broccoli florets, celery pieces, and turmeric in it for 3 minutes over medium heat. Pour in the broth, season with salt and pepper, and let the soup simmer for about 15 minutes.
- 3. Meanwhile, prepare the gremolata: Wash the parsley, shake it dry, and chop it finely. Roughly chop the hazelnuts. Mix the parsley with the nuts, lemon zest, and the remaining oil. Season the mixture with salt, pepper, and chili flakes.
- 4. Taste the soup again, fill it into bowls, and serve it topped with the gremolata.
Nutrition per serving
- kcal: 283
- Protein: 10 g · Fett/Fat: 23 g · Carbs: 9 g
